Welltec® provides tailored solutions for geothermal well completions operating across a wide thermal range, from low-temperature direct-use systems to high-temperature resources.
When demands are extreme, Welltec® offers the only solutions on the market capable of withstanding temperatures above 330°C and delivering 1,000,000 lbs of anchoring capacity – combining the Welltec® Magma Packer (WMP) and the Welltec® Expandable Anchor (WEA).
This combination ensures long-term annular integrity in the most demanding environments, and is engineered for exceptional load-bearing capacity and thermal resilience.
Furthermore, our broad portfolio of completion solutions – including the Welltec® Annular Barrier (WAB®), and the Welltec® Light Packer (WLP) – has applications in zonal isolation, flow control, cement assurance, and reservoir compartmentalization, across the operating temperature range of geothermal wells.
Welltec® Flow Valves (WFV™) complete a flow control system for large bores with no internal restrictions, providing effective injection/production control in geothermal wells.
Through a range of proven metal expandable packer solutions, Welltec delivers fullbore completions capable of withstanding acidic corrosion and extreme pressure/temperature swings/cycling associated with the geothermal environment.

Our broad portfolio of intervention solutions supports efficient scale removal and cleanout in mid- to low-temperature wells (up to 150°C), as well as quenched high-temperature wells – all with minimal environmental impact through e-line deployment. With over 30 years of experience in scale removal from oil and gas wells, Welltec® brings proven expertise to geothermal operations, restoring flow and optimizing production.
Silica and calcite buildup is a common challenge in geothermal wells, driven by reservoir variability and thermodynamic shifts over time. E-line conveyed technologies like the Well Miller® offer a rigless, low-footprint alternative using a truck-mounted winch and crane – making them ideal for interventions in areas where space is at a premium.
